Short-term depression and long-term enhancement of ACh-gated channel currents induced by linoleic and linolenic acid.
Brain research - 21 Mar 1997
Nishizaki T, Ikeuchi Y, Matsuoka T, Sumikawa K
Abstract excerpt
The effects of cis-unsaturated free fatty acids such as linoleic and linolenic acid on ACh-evoked currents were examined using normal and mutant nicotinic acetylcholine (ACh) receptors lacking protein kinase C (PKC) phosphorylation sites on the alpha and delta subunits expressed in Xenopus oocytes. These free fatty acids reduced ACh-gated channel currents during treatment and to a greater extent in Ca2+-free...
